I too am surprised the application selection feature is completely gone now. https://www.cpdn.org/prefs.php?subset=project Various old models would take up 10's of gigabytes. At various points, I would have to periodically delete old models in order to download any new units. By selecting only a few models, this was less of a problem. Also, in the past, the researchers were able to use different platforms as a way to validate a model. Since floating point calculations, etc. varied slightly, it helped them tune the models with a bigger variety of data points. If such an emergent result is no longer useful, then I would highly recommend they post the minimum requirements per platform. (For example, these could go on the CPDN homepage next to the how to join section.) |

https://boinc.berkeley.edu/trac/wiki/AppFiltering BOINC offers two mechanisms allowing users to control the set of apps for which they get jobs. The first, lets you designate apps as "beta test", and lets users opt-in to getting jobs for these apps. The second, "app filtering", lets users select apps individually. App filtering is disabled by default. To enable it, add to your html/project/project_specific_prefs.inc: define ('APP_SELECT_PREFS', true); The app filtering user interface is part of project-specific preferences (i.e., the "Preferences for this project" link on their account page). If the feature is enabled, users are shown: •A list of apps and check boxes. •A checkbox labeled "If no work for selected applications is available, accept work from other applications?". |

Sandman If you're talking about the one in the Notices tab, then you need to log out of your account, and then attempt to log back in. At which point you'll get a page explaining the new GDPR rules, and you have to either tick or ignore the option at the bottom. This is about giving your permission to export your personal CPDN information to the external stats sites. I'm not sure what happens if you don't agree; possibly all of the info already stored on those sites will disappear. If you're talking about a message in the BOINC Events Log, then you'll have to copy it and paste it here so that we can see it. Plus a few lines either side may be useful. |
